How to Sleep Better: Ten Evening Routines Are you an early bird, or a morning grouch? If you admire people who are full of energy and ready for action in the early hours of the day, you’ve probably also wondered where these people get their power from. One of the most basic tricks is a good night’s sleep. We know that adults need between six and eight hours of sleep, depending on your metabolism. But it’s not only getting enough hours of sleep – your energy levels are determined by how well you sleep. Here are ten evening activities that successful people to help them reach their full potential the next day and every day.

Take a Walk or Jog Don’t go out and run a half-marathon right before getting into bed, but taking a short walk in the evening or a light jog will help you process the day, reduce stress, and make you sleepy. Lots of high-level executives swear by this evening ritual.
